How they compare

Algeria currently reports 0.2% against 0.1% in Brunei, a difference of 0.1%.

That makes Algeria's figure about 1.2 times Brunei's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 40 shared years of data; in 1966 it was Algeria ahead.

Algeria ranks 178th and Brunei ranks 179th of 194 countries.

Algeria has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Algeria Brunei Difference Ahead
1960s 3.0% 0.1% 2.9% Algeria
1970s 1.6% 0.0% 1.6% Algeria
1980s 0.6% 0.0% 0.5% Algeria
1990s 0.5% 0.0% 0.5% Algeria
2000s 0.5% 0.1% 0.4% Algeria
2010s 0.2% 0.2% 0.1% Algeria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Ores and metals comprise the commodities in SITC (Rev. 3) sections 27 (crude fertilizer, minerals nes); 28 (metalliferous ores, scrap); and 68 (non-ferrous metals). Exports of services are services provided by residents to non-residents. This indicator is expressed as a percentage of merchandise exports which is comprised of goods whose economic ownership is changed between a resident and a non-resident and that are not included in the following specific categories: goods under merchanting, non-monetary gold, and parts of travel, construction, and government goods and services n.i.e.
